Hyundai Motor Company's total assets reached KRW 194,512 bil at the end of 2019, up 7.67% compared to the previous year.
Current assets amounted to KRW 76,083 bil, or 39.1% of total assets while cash stood at KRW 25,375 bil at the end of 2019.
By contrast, total debt reached KRW 82,140 bil at the year-end, or 42.2% of total assets, while the firm's equity amounted to KRW 76,366 bil. As a result, net debt stood at KRW 56,766 bil at the end of 2019 and accounted for 74.3% of equity.
Net debt against equity is up 29.1 pp from five years ago (45.2%). The ratio against EBITDA increased from 3.01x seen in 2014 to 8.98x.
The company’s cost of funding amounted to 0.408% in 2019, down 0.015 pp compared to the average over the last 5 years.
